a thanks firmware 9.0 is good to get custom firmware?
9.0-9.2 is the glory zone for cfw. But anything lower than 9.3 can get cfw, either through MSET, spider, or other means. It's recommended to go through the entire arm9loaderhax guide https://github.com/Plailect/Guide/wiki to install arm9loaderhax so you can keep your sysNAND updated, and run hacks the second you boot your 3DS. If you're uneasy about following it, just follow this guide to https://github.com/Plailect/Guide/wiki/Get-Started-(Old-3DS---EUR) to update/downgrade 9.2 and install menuhax for your DS.
